What substance characterizes Stony meteorites, placing them in the most common group?
Answer
Rich in silicates
Stony meteorites constitute the most voluminous group among the three major compositional families of meteorites found globally. Their defining characteristic is that they are rich in silicate minerals, which form the bulk of their mass. This places them at one end of the compositional scale when contrasted with iron meteorites, which are defined by their high metal content. Because they are found with much greater frequency than iron or stony-iron varieties, they form the baseline against which the rarity of other specific subclasses, such as aubrites or carbonaceous chondrites, is measured.
